The Buddhist Handbook

A Complete Guide to Buddhist Teaching and Practice

Author: John Snelling  

New edition of this classic Buddhist handbook.

Revised and updated in a new edition by Gill Farrer-Halls, who runs the Meridian Trust, this is an explanation of the basic teachings of Buddhism and its main schools, as well as the Buddhist world-view, leading Buddhist teachers, Buddhist festivals and meditation techniques.
